What is it?

We are excited to announce our upcoming online #ERUAiDeathon2024, taking place on November 25-26, 2024. #ERUAiDeathon2024 brings together bright minds from across the ERUA network to address two critical social challenges through social entrepreneurial thinking.

Who can participate?

We invite all students, researchers, faculty and staff from ERUA members to participate. You can join as an individual (we’ll help you find a team) or as part of a team of 3-5 members. Participation of local stakeholders in your team is welcome.

What are the challenges we are trying to overcome?

We’re seeking innovative ideas in two primary areas:

  1. Migration, Exile & Refugees
  2. Democracy and Human Rights, Inclusion, Gender Equality.

More about the ERUA iDeaTHon 2024

Aim: These events aim to solve specific problems or challenges through brainstorming sessions, encouraging out-of-the-box thinking, and pushing boundaries. By creating an environment conducive to idea generation and collaboration, ideathons have become popular in various fields, including technology, business, and social innovation.

Participants: Organisations can benefit from involving both students and external experts in ideathons. Students can have valuable and pure insights into operations and challenges, while external experts bring fresh perspectives from different fields.

Team size: The size of teams participating in an ideathon can vary depending on the nature of the challenge. Smaller teams may foster more focused discussions and quick decision-making, while larger teams can bring together diverse expertise and skill sets. In our case we aim at teams of maximum 4 people.

Role of rewards: To ensure active participation during an ideathon, it is essential to offer incentives or rewards that motivate participants to contribute their best ideas. This could include cash prizes, internships, or even position offers for outstanding performers. Nailing the Problem Statement for an Ideathon

A well-defined problem statement is crucial for a successful ideathon, as it guides participants’ creativity and leads to relevant solutions.The problem statement should be concise, specific, and effectively communicate the challenge or issue at hand. In order to formulate problem statements for ideathons, involving subject matter experts or industry professionals can be beneficial. Their expertise can provide valuable insights and help ensure that the problem statement accurately reflects real-world challenges. By collaborating with these individuals, organizers can tap into their knowledge and experience to create problem statements that resonate with participants.

Additionally, providing background information or context related to the problem statement is important. This additional information helps participants better understand the scope of the challenge and allows them to approach it from an informed perspective. By providing context, organizers can set the stage for innovative thinking and encourage participants to come up with unique solutions. Overall, a clear and well-constructed problem statement sets the foundation for successful innovation in ideathons by ensuring that participants fully understand the challenge they are trying to solve and providing a common starting point for all participants.
